WebSep 11, 2011 · Chest-tube insertion may cause bleeding, especially if a vessel is accidentally cut. Usually, bleeding is minor and resolves on its own, but bleeding into or around the lung may warrant surgical intervention. WebNov 9, 2013 · Chest tubes also can be used to remove collections of fluid (effusions) such as blood, pus, chyle or serous fluid and/or air from the pleural space. … WebAssessment of chest tube and system tubing should occur at the beginning of the shift and every hour throughout the shift. Tubing should have no kinks or obstructions that may inhibit drainage. Never lift drain above chest level. The unit and all tubing should be below patient’s chest level to facilitate drainage.
